1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ause)
4 $id: http://devicetree.org/schemas/power/renesas,sysc-rmobile.yaml#
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
7 title: Renesas R-Mobile System Controller
10 - Geert Uytterhoeven <geert+renesas@glider.be>
11 - Magnus Damm <magnus.damm@gmail.com>
14 The R-Mobile System Controller provides the following functions:
15 - Boot mode management,
23 - renesas,sysc-r8a73a4 # R-Mobile APE6
24 - renesas,sysc-r8a7740 # R-Mobile A1
25 - renesas,sysc-sh73a0 # SH-Mobile AG5
26 - const: renesas,sysc-rmobile # Generic SH/R-Mobile
30 - description: Normally accessible register block
31 - description: Register block protected by the HPB semaphore
36 This node contains a hierarchy of PM domain nodes, which should match the
37 Power Area Hierarchy in the Power Domain Specifications section of the
48 $ref: "#/$defs/pd-node"
55 additionalProperties: false
61 PM domain node representing a PM domain. This node should be named by
62 the real power area name, and thus its name should be unique.
68 If the PM domain is not always-on, this property must contain the
69 bit index number for the corresponding power area in the various
70 Power Control and Status Registers.
71 If the PM domain is always-on, this property must be omitted.
79 '#power-domain-cells':
83 - '#power-domain-cells'
86 $ref: "#/$defs/pd-node"
90 // This shows a subset of the r8a7740 PM domain hierarchy, containing the
91 // C5 "always-on" domain, 2 of its subdomains (A4S and A4SU), and the A3SP
92 // domain, which is a subdomain of A4S.
93 sysc: system-controller@e6180000 {
94 compatible = "renesas,sysc-r8a7740", "renesas,sysc-rmobile";
95 reg = <0xe6180000 0x8000>, <0xe6188000 0x8000>;
101 #power-domain-cells = <0>;
105 #address-cells = <1>;
107 #power-domain-cells = <0>;
111 #power-domain-cells = <0>;
117 #power-domain-cells = <0>;